Semenyo scores only goal as Man City beat Leeds United to close gap with Arsenal

Manchester City fought their way into a narrow 1-0 win over Leeds United at Elland Road to reduce the gap adrift of Premier League table leaders Arsenal to just two points.
Despite being without Erling Haaland, who was absent from the matchday squad due to an injury he suffered in training, City survived late pressure from Leeds to keep the title race very close.
A goal by Antoine Semenyo just before the halftime whistle, after tapping home a through pass from Rayan Ait Nouri, was enough to secure the important three points for Pep Guardiola’s side.
It was Semenyo’s 14th Premier League goal, taking his total goal contributions to 18. The result meant City are now unbeaten in their last nine matches across all competitions, winning eight of them.
Speaking after the match, Semenyo said, “It means everything! We just want to win all our games, and whatever Arsenal do, we’ll just have to wait and see. We just need to control what we can control, win our games, and we’ll see what happens.”
Manchester City fans will shift their focus to the biggest match of the weekend, Arsenal vs Chelsea at the Emirates Stadium on Sunday, hoping to see the Gunners drop points.
